T-Mobile Jet 2.0 HSPA+ modem lifts off March 23rd?

Two rumors don’t make a USB dongle, but things certainly appear to add up — one leaked document told us T-Mobile would get its first 21Mbps HSPA+ WWAN modem in March, and now a second one (all over again courtesy of TmoNews) pegs the T-Mobile Jet’s “value-conscious” successor for the 23rd of this month. For sure, if that first document was correct, there are faster 42Mbps modems just round the corner. Your call.
